Black Friday Ready: 300% Revenue Growth
How we transformed ShopMax's struggling e-commerce platform into a high-performance powerhouse that handled 100,000+ concurrent users during Black Friday, achieving 300% revenue growth and zero downtime.
Executive Summary
ShopMax, a growing retail platform, approached XYZBytes just 8 weeks before Black Friday with a critical challenge: their platform couldn't handle the expected traffic surge. With Black Friday 2024 generating $10.8 billion in U.S. e-commerce sales alone, the stakes couldn't be higher.
Our team completely transformed their infrastructure using Next.js and AWS, implementing advanced caching strategies, auto-scaling architecture, and performance optimizations. The results exceeded all expectations: 300% revenue increase, 99.99% uptime during peak traffic, and page load speeds improved from 7+ seconds to under 1.2 seconds.
The Challenge
Client Background
ShopMax was a mid-size retail platform processing $2M monthly revenue with 50,000 active customers. Their existing PHP-based platform was struggling under normal traffic and completely unprepared for the 10x traffic surge expected during Black Friday.
Market Context
E-commerce platforms face extreme challenges during BFCM, with mobile traffic reaching 80% of total visits and conversion rates spiking to 6.4% (vs. typical 1-4%). A single second of delay can reduce conversions by 12%.
Critical Issues
- Legacy infrastructure limitations
- Database bottlenecks during traffic spikes
- Slow page load speeds (7+ seconds)
- Checkout failures during peak periods
- Limited mobile optimization
- Inadequate monitoring and alerting
Technical Solution
Architecture Transformation
We rebuilt the platform using Next.js with server-side rendering for optimal performance and SEO. The new serverless architecture on AWS Lambda provided automatic scaling for traffic spikes without the overhead of managing servers.
Performance Strategy
Implemented a multi-layer caching strategy with CloudFront CDN for global content delivery, Redis for application caching, and optimized database queries with read replicas for high-traffic scenarios.
Technology Implementation
- Next.js with SSR for optimal performance
- AWS auto-scaling infrastructure
- PostgreSQL with Redis caching layer
- CloudFront CDN for global content delivery
- Lambda functions for serverless scaling
- Real-time monitoring with DataDog
Performance Transformation
Page Load Speed
Conversion Rate
Mobile Performance
Server Response
Implementation Process
Infrastructure Assessment & Planning
Analyzed current bottlenecks, designed scalable architecture, and set up AWS infrastructure
Platform Migration & Optimization
Migrated to Next.js, implemented caching strategies, and optimized database queries
Testing & Black Friday Preparation
Conducted extensive load testing, fine-tuned auto-scaling, and prepared monitoring dashboards
Black Friday Success
(vs $1.8M previous year)
(Peak Traffic Handled)
(Industry avg: 1.2%)
Zero downtime during the entire Black Friday weekend, processing over 50,000 orders with an average page load time of 1.2 seconds.
"XYZBytes saved our Black Friday – and probably our business. Not only did we handle record traffic flawlessly, but our customers noticed the dramatic improvement in site speed. We've maintained those performance gains ever since, and our conversion rates have stayed consistently higher."
Ready to Scale Your E-commerce Platform?
Don't let traffic spikes cost you revenue. Let's build a platform that grows with your success.